Abstract

A data storage system having a non IC based memory and an IC based non-volatile memory for storing user data. In one example, the IC based non-volatile memory is implemented with MRAM. Examples of non IC based memory include e.g. hard disks, tape, and compact disks. In some examples, the IC based memory is utilized to store user data from an information device in order to increase the speed and/or the effective storage capacity of the data storage system. In some examples, a portion of a standard size block of user data can be stored on spaces of the non IC based memory that are deficient for storing a standard size block with the remaining portion being stored in IC based memory. Portions of a file of user data may be non-volatilely stored in the IC based memory in order to more quickly provide the file to an information device. For example, data of a file, that if stored in a location on the non IC based media would significantly increase the retrieval time of the file, can be stored in the IC based media.

Claims (22)

1. A data storage system comprising:

an input configured to receive user data from an information source;

a non-integrated circuit based storage media configured to store user data; and

an integrated circuit based non-volatile memory (NVM), the non-volatile memory configured to also store user data;

wherein the data storage system is configured to store data in a plurality of hard disk surfaces in a data striping configuration, wherein a portion of the user data is stored in a set of storage units wherein each storage unit of the set is located on a different disk surface, wherein the integrated circuit based non-volatile memory (NVM) is configured to store data for a storage unit of the set that is determined to be defective.

2. A data storage system comprising:

a non-integrated circuit based storage media configured to store user data;

a processor operably coupled to the non-integrated circuit based media; and

an integrated circuit based non-volatile memory (NVM) operably coupled to the processor, the non-volatile memory configured to also store user data;

wherein:

the system is configured to non-volatilely store a file of user data in a plurality of standard size blocks of data;

the non-integrated circuit based storage media is configured to store user data in a plurality of storage units;

a deficient storage unit of the plurality of storage units is deficient for storing a standard size block of data;

the deficient storage unit is configured to non-volatilely store one portion of a standard size block of data;

the integrated circuit based non-volatile memory is configured to store an other portion of the standard size block of data whose one portion is stored in the deficient storage unit.

3. The data storage system of claim 2 wherein the non-integrated circuit based storage media includes a hard disk, wherein the deficient storage unit is located adjacent to a sector line of the hard disk.

4. A data storage system comprising:

a non-integrated circuit based storage media configured to store user data;

a processor operably coupled to the non-integrated circuit based media; and

an integrated circuit based non-volatile memory (NVM) operably coupled to the processor, the non-volatile memory configured to also store user data;

wherein the system is configured to non-volatilely store a file of user data in a plurality of ordered blocks of data, wherein a portion of the ordered blocks of data is non-volatilely stored in storage units of the non-integrated circuit based storage media, and wherein an other portion of the ordered blocks of data is non-volatilely stored in the integrated circuit based non-volatile memory, wherein at least a portion of the other portion of the ordered blocks of data non-volatilely stored in the integrated circuit based non-volatile memory is not non-volatilely stored in the non-integrated circuit based storage media;

wherein the first portion of the ordered blocks of data has a fixed data size and the second portion of the ordered blocks of data has a variable data size.
